Contemplative verse is a type of poetry that focuses on deep reflection, meditation, and personal introspection. This genre often explores themes of spirituality, nature, and the human experience, encouraging readers to pause and think critically about their own lives and beliefs. In the context of early American women's poetry, contemplative verse serves as a means for female poets to express their inner thoughts and feelings in a society that often limited their voices.
